Openmp pthread which is faster

http://www.dalkescientific.com/writings/diary/archive/2012/01/13/openmp_vs_posix_threads.html#:~:text=You%20can%20see%20that%20the%20OpenMP%20code%20%28in,means%20this%20stores%20a%20few%20gigabytes%20of%20data. Web4 de mai. de 2024 · An OpenMP application’s parts might be sequential or parallel. For example, an OpenMP program often begins with a sequential selection that sets up the environment and initializes the variables. When an OpenMP application is launched, it will use one thread (in the sequential portions) and numerous threads (in the parallel sections).

OpenBLAS and OpenMP in a single application - Google Groups

WebWhich one is faster MPI, PTHREAD or OPENMP? why? Solution 5 (1 Ratings ) Solved Computer Science 3 Years Ago 68 Views This Question has Been Answered! View Solution Related Answers Question Which one is primarily designed for supporting the decision making systems? OODBMS ORDBMS NoSQL RDBMS ... Web26 de ago. de 2016 · pthread might be faster or just as fast if std::thread is based on pthread (usually is), the performance of code executed inside the thread should be equivalent. vickoza • 7 yr. ago openssh key generator online https://austexcommunity.com

(PDF) Performance and power comparisons of MPI Vs Pthread ...

Web13 de abr. de 2015 · Just commented all OpenMP's pragmas and application started behave predictably, much faster, with increasing performance as number of cores for OpenBLAS increases. ... In OpenBLAS library, there are two parallel implementations including pthread and OpenMP. By default, OpenBLAS uses pthread to parallelize BLAS functions, ... http://www.diva-portal.org/smash/get/diva2:944063/FULLTEXT02 Web18 de fev. de 2013 · Right now I would strongly suggest pthreads or boost threads over OpenMP. Establishing and maintaining thread-context affinity in CUDA with OpenMP is … ipb publication

Which is the best parallel programming language for initiating ...

Category:ExtremeScale/std-thread_vs_openmp - Github

Tags:Openmp pthread which is faster

Openmp pthread which is faster

pthreads vs. OpenMP? - CUDA Programming and Performance

Web1 de out. de 2000 · Request PDF OpenMP versus threading in C/C++ When comparing OpenMP to other parallel programming models, it is easier to choose between OpenMP and MPI than between OpenMP and POSIX Threads ... WebThe thread-level parallelism managed by OpenMP in scikit-learn’s own Cython code or by BLAS & LAPACK libraries used by NumPy and SciPy operations used in scikit-learn is always controlled by environment variables or threadpoolctl as explained below.

Openmp pthread which is faster

Did you know?

WebWhich one is faster MPI, PTHREAD or OPENMP? why? This probl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core … Web23 de fev. de 2024 · For many frequencies, it is often fastest to run the serial LAPACK versions in completely fork ()ed parallelism (one job per frequency), rather than run fewer …

http://www.dalkescientific.com/writings/diary/archive/2012/01/13/openmp_vs_posix_threads.html WebAnswer (1 of 5): Entrance to CUDA is easier than CPU multithreading. You just give it a kernel function and it launches same function N times in parallel. No threads, no thread-thread synchronizations. Just 1 function call and an optional gpu-cpu synchronization once. CPU multithreading is a bit...

Web1 de mar. de 2004 · The OpenMP framework [59] can be used to benefit from parallel processing made possible with available multicore processors. Parallelism and scalability in an image processing application is ... WebPawanKL/Pthread-vs-OpenMP – GitHub. Pthread is low level implementation and OpenMp is higher level implementation. For example we assembly language and C language. OpenMp do all the stuff by just … + Read More Here. Pthreads vs. OpenMP. On the other hand, OpenMP is much higher level, is more portable and doesn’t limit you to using C.

WebParallel Computing with OpenMP#. OpenMP is an API that implements a multi-threaded, shared memory form of parallelism. It uses a set of compiler directives (statements that you add to your code and that are recognised by your Fortran/C/C++ compiler if OpenMP is enabled or otherwise ignored) that are incorporated at compile-time to generate a multi …

Web29 de mar. de 2024 · I'm using OpenCV on my Raspberry Pi 3 which has 4 cores. Right now it is compiled with PThreads. Would OpenMP or TBB perform better? Or does it … openssh latest version for redhat 6Web• OpenMP and Pthreads are common models ♦ OpenMP provides convenient features for loop-level parallelism. Threads are created and managed by the compiler, based on user directives. ♦ Pthreads provide more complex and dynamic approaches. Threads are created and managed explicitly by the user. ipb pub armyWebDownload scientific diagram Performance of Sequential vs. Parallel Matrix Multiplication using OpenMP, T BB, Pthread, Cilk++ and MPI from publication: A comparison of five … ipb publication armyWeb2. Though OpenMP thread and pthread do not know each other, but in most of cases (not guaranteed), they don’t mess up the threads. So we can do global affinity setting by environment variable or OS affinity function. 3. Though OpenMP thread and pthread don’t know each other, we still can control the OpenMP openssh latest version for ubuntuWebAs Raul Baños said C/C++ with openMP and MPI is a good start for parallel programming but I think before using this language, undergraduate students may understand the concept of parallel ... ip breastwork\u0027sWeb13 de jan. de 2012 · You can see that the OpenMP code (in red) is usually faster than the pthread code (in blue). The exception is for thresholds of 0.55 and lower. BTW, a … ip breadbox\u0027sWebDownload scientific diagram Performance of Sequential vs. Parallel Matrix Multiplication using OpenMP, T BB, Pthread, Cilk++ and MPI from publication: A comparison of five parallel programming ... ip breadwinner\u0027s